Cloud Engineering Lead
1 month ago
Successful Candidates will oversee the design, development, and deployment of applications into a Cloud or Hybrid Cloud and implementation of enterprise infrastructure and platforms required for cloud computing.
The ideal Cloud Engineering Lead will have a broad technical background, a solid understanding of applicable analytics, and experience in producing effective solutions. They must be able to recommend and engineer solutions from conception to deployment. This role is hands on and fully integrated within a team of other subject matter experts. The ideal candidate embraces the concepts of servant leadership and being an agent of change, as part of a larger team.
Additional Responsibilities include:Architecting and leading the development and integration of cloud-based information and computer systems that meet specific needs, as identified in the SOW.Accountable for the end-to-end cloud deployment experience, from concept development to deployment.Required Education, Experience, & Skills Bachelor's degree in business, computer science, management information systems, or related technical field.5+ years of experience supporting cloud architecture design, development, implementation, and maintenance.A minimum of one of the following professional certifications:
- Professional Cloud Solutions Architect (PCSA)
- AWS Solutions Architect (Professional)
- A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ner
- AWS Certified SysOps Administrator (Associate)
- AWS Certified DevOps Engineer (Professional)
- AWS Certified Big Data (Specialty)
